    A Securities and Exchange Commission

    The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ission, commonly called SEC, is a government organization that oversees the securities industry. It was founded in the year 1934 to protect investors and promote the integrity of the securities market. The SEC has broad power over a wide range of securities transactions, including registration of securities offerings. It also investigates potential infractions of securities laws and imposes penalties against wrongdoers.

    Investment Regulations Understanding Reg A+

    Regulation A+, often known as Reg A+, is a provision within United States securities laws that allows companies to raise capital from the general public through offerings. It offers a streamlined and less expensive alternative to traditional initial public offerings (IPOs), making it an attractive option for smaller businesses seeking funding. Reg A+ permits companies to sell up to $75 million in securities within a twelve-month period.

    Regulation A+ crowdfunding platforms serve as intermediaries, connecting issuers with potential investors. These platforms facilitate the entire process, from creating and filing public disclosures to handling investor subscriptions and managing payments. By leveraging technology and streamlined procedures, Reg A+ platforms aim to make fundraising more accessible for both companies and individual investors.

    Regulation A+ Securities Act of 1933 Jobs Act 106 Reg A Tier 2 Offering raise funding

    The Regulation A+ under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ended by the Jobs Act of 2012, provides a path for companies to raise capital through public sales. Reg A Tier 2, in particular, allows qualified businesses to sell securities to the public on a larger scale than Tier 1. This tier offers greater flexibility and access to funding compared to traditional methods including initial public offerings (IPOs). Companies utilizing Regulation A+ Tier 2 must comply with certain requirements, including filing a detailed prospectus with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and adhering to ongoing reporting obligations.

    Rule A vs Rule D

    When evaluating funding options for your business, it's essential to familiarize yourself with the nuances of multiple regulations. Two common regulatory frameworks that often come up in this context are {Regulation A and Regulation D|. These rules provide distinct methodologies for raising capital, each with its own set of requirements. Regulation A, often referred to as a mini-IPO, allows companies to tap into a broader investor base through equity issuances. Conversely, Regulation D focuses on private placements, enabling businesses to issue securities privately. Both present unique opportunities and challenges, so it's crucial for entrepreneurs to meticulously evaluate which regulatory framework best aligns with their strategic aspirations.
